Управляемые сборки на Linux

У нас есть TFS-сервер, на котором выполняется сборка нашего программного обеспечения для Windows.
Теперь нам пришлось перенести часть нашего программного обеспечения на Linux, и мы хотим запускать сборки аналогичным образом на Linux.
Проект для Linux создан с использованием Eclipse CDT, написанного на C ++. Вопрос заключается в том, как запустить сборки этого проекта на компьютере с Linux, и можно ли будет каким-то образом интегрировать его в инфраструктуру TFS? Для контроля качества и т. Д.

0

Решение

Нет готового решения: в настоящее время нет агентов для Linux.

Но подождите, я сделал это один раз для клиента. Части решения были:

  1. настроить SSH в Linux
  2. написать скрипт сборки Linux и сохранить его в системе управления версиями TFS
  3. измените пользовательский шаблон, используя Расширения сообщества, чтобы:
    а. нажмите сценарий
    б. вызывать скрипт удалённо
    с. собрать журнал сборки
    д. скопировать логи в OutDir

Я написал сообщение в блоге с подробной инструкцией: http://casavian.eu/wordpress/2014/02/13/integrating-linux-builds-in-tfs/.

0

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]